Output 3ae267fdd8dbfcdcb77891b8cc98d3ecbe9d847d5d3eef80eed03a4f8b8f67ee:8

value
759
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f86c24843def8eb3104f21440c262588f96fa5f0eb87da78b103fe6e73e721e5
address
bc1plpkzfppaa78txyz0y9zqcf393ruklf0sawra5793q0lxuul8y8js2q5475
transaction
3ae267fdd8dbfcdcb77891b8cc98d3ecbe9d847d5d3eef80eed03a4f8b8f67ee
spent
true